Description

Fine 19th-century edition of a Ptolemaic world map, showing the world as it was known to the ancients.

The map shows Europe, Asia, and Africa in a form somewhat recognizable to the modern observer. Europe is roughly correct in its outline, but Africa and Asia are difficult to decipher in parts. Africa wraps around to southeast Asia in a "Terra Incognita." India is foreshortened, while Sri Lanka (Taprobana) is vastly oversized. Mountain ranges and rivers appear throughout.

This map was published by Francesco Marmocchi in Florence in 1838.
